A man has been arrested following a disturbance at a shop in Stoke-on-Trent yesterday (15 January).

Police were called to Century Retail Park in Hanley just before 8pm, following reports of a man stealing items and threatening retail security staff.

On arrival, officers discovered a knife, a quantity of drugs and suspected stolen bank and gift cards.

A 38-year-old man, of no fixed address, has since been arrested on suspicion of affray, possession of a class B drug, possession of a blade or pointed article in a public place, theft and theft from a shop.

He has also been arrested on suspicion of burglary dwelling and burglary other than dwelling with intent to steal following two separate burglaries in the Stoke-on-Trent area, recently.

He was interviewed in custody and has since been released under conditional police bail while enquires continue.
